Can a child safety seat be fitted in a motorhome?
Most campervan hire companies in the UK have vehicle options that allow child safety seats. UK law generally requires children to use an appropriate child car seat until they’re 12 years old or 135 cm tall (whichever comes first). Always confirm seatbelt/ISOFIX compatibility and that you can install the seat correctly before you book.
What kind of licence do I need to drive a motorhome in the UK?
All drivers must have a current and full driving licence to hire a vehicle. If your licence is from the UK, a standard Category B licence typically covers vehicles up to 3,500kg MAM (check the vehicle’s MAM before you book). Heavier motorhomes may require Category C1 (3.5–7.5t) or Category C (over 7.5t).
Foreign licences are often accepted for visiting drivers, but the rules depend on where your licence was issued and whether it is in English. You may need an International Driving Permit (IDP) or an official translation—check GOV.UK guidance and your supplier before you book.
Can I hire a motorhome in the UK if I’m under 21?
Minimum driver age and licence-holding requirements vary by supplier and vehicle class. Most campervan hire companies in the UK require the driver to be 21 or over. In addition, you must have held your licence for a specific period of time (generally between 2–5 years). Certain vehicles may be restricted for drivers under the age of 25.
